94th Euroconstruct Conference: European Construction Market Outlook until 2025 – Austrian Construction Market Development. Country Report Austria

Michael Klien and Michael Weingärtler

Abstract: The Austrian construction industry will stagnate in 2022, despite high production increases. The massive increase in construction costs, which are expected to rise by around 10 percent in 2022 compared to the previous year, will dampen real growth in the construction industry significantly. In combination with the already expected downward trend in residential construction, 2023 will also see only low growth rates. The years 2024 and 2025 will then also be characterised by only weak momentum with rates below 1 percent, despite clear impulses in civil engineering.
